How SpinOut Advisory Services Support Compliance
SpinOut Advisory services measures six key pillars of governance and investor readiness:-
Governance Setup: Establishing a board, defining roles, and setting policies.
Leadership and Accountability: Setting clear roles and tracking priorities
Commercial Progress: Conversion of product or offering into market traction
Financial Reporting: Implementing regular, transparent financial reports.
Risk Management: Identifying risks and creating mitigation plans.
Investor Readiness: Ensure documents and processes are ready for investor review.
These services do not take over management. Instead, they empower founders to maintain autonomy while meeting investor expectations. This balance is critical for early-stage startups navigating complex regulatory environments.

Practical Steps to Achieve Compliance
Achieving a system of good governance is a step-by-step process which gets more complex as a new venture grows. Here are practical recommendations where SpinOut Advisory can help:-
Engage Early: Contact SpinOut Advisory services after incorporation/registration
Define Governance: Set up a board with clear roles and responsibilities.
Implement Reporting: Establish regular financial and operational reporting.
Identify Risks: Conduct risk assessments and develop mitigation strategies.
Track Milestones: Use project management tools to monitor progress.
Maintain Communication: Keep investors and stakeholders informed regularly.
Prepare for Due Diligence: Start early. Organise all legal, financial, and operational documents.
By following these steps, founder's make their lives easier and remove uncertainty around decisions, authority levels, reporting gaps, board packs etc. Startups can reduce compliance risks, demonstrate the company is well managed and and improve their chances of securing funding.
